St. Francesco Fasani

November 27
Italian.
1681-1742

A pious child. Entered the Conventual Franciscan order in 1695, taking the name Francis. Ordained in 1705. Taught philosophy to younger friars, served as guardian of his friary, provincial of the order, master of novices, and finally pastor in his hometown. Sought after confessor and preacher, a loyal friend of the poor, never hesitating to seek from benefactors what was needed. A mystic, known for his deep prayer life and supernatural gifts, he was known to levitate while praying. At his death, children ran through the streets crying, "The saint is dead! The saint is dead!"

"In his preaching he spoke in a familiar way, filled as he was with the love of God and neighbor; fired by the Spirit, he made use of the words and deed of Holy Scripture, stirring his listeners and moving them to do penance." - a witness to his preaching, recorded in the investigation for his canonization
